Parallel Computing: Lecture 13

Learning objectives

After this class, you should be able to:

  1. Given speedup data for a code, compute the Karp-Flatt metric and determine the cause of the bottleneck to parallelization.
  2. Given a parallel algorithm, determine its iso-efficiency function and its scalability function.

Reading assignment

  1. Chapter 7, sections 7.5 - 7.7.
  2. Chapter 8, page 179.

Exercises and review questions


Last modified: 20 Feb 2007